As a part of our search for new types of detergent useful for biological applications, a series of alkyl-β-D-thioglucopyranosides was synthesized in several steps from glucose. The overall yield was about 80%. Critical micelle concentrations of n-hexyl-, n-heptyl-, n-octyl-, and n-nonyl-β-D-thioglucopyranoside were determined. Because of their electroneutrality, high solubility in water and high critical micelle concentration, n-heptyl-and n-octyl-β-D-thioglucopyranoside seem to be potentially useful detergents for applications in biological systems.
